/external/libvpx/libvpx/vpx_dsp/arm/ |
highbd_loopfilter_neon.c | 154 uint16x8_t *oq1, uint16x8_t *oq2) { 167 *oq1 = calc_7_tap_filter_kernel(p2, q0, q1, q3, &sum); 178 uint16x8_t *oq1, uint16x8_t *oq2) { 186 *oq1 = vbslq_u16(flat, tq1, *oq1); 199 uint16x8_t *op0, uint16x8_t *oq0, uint16x8_t *oq1, uint16x8_t *oq2, 221 *oq1 = apply_15_tap_filter_kernel(flat2, p6, q0, q1, q7, *oq1, &sum); 233 uint16x8_t *oq1, const int bd) { 286 *oq1 = flip_sign_back(qs1, bd) 616 op2, op1, op0, oq0, oq1, oq2, mask, flat, hev; local 640 op2, op1, op0, oq0, oq1, oq2, mask, flat, hev; local 670 q3, q4, q5, q6, q7, op6, op5, op4, op3, op2, op1, op0, oq0, oq1, oq2, oq3, local 693 q3, q4, q5, q6, q7, op6, op5, op4, op3, op2, op1, op0, oq0, oq1, oq2, oq3, local [all...] |
loopfilter_neon.c | 238 uint8x8_t *oq1, uint8x8_t *oq2) { 251 *oq1 = calc_7_tap_filter_8_kernel(p2, q0, q1, q3, &sum); 259 uint8x16_t *op0, uint8x16_t *oq0, uint8x16_t *oq1, uint8x16_t *oq2) { 279 *oq1 = calc_7_tap_filter_16_kernel(p2, q0, q1, q3, &sum0, &sum1); 289 uint8x##w##_t *op0, uint8x##w##_t *oq0, uint8x##w##_t *oq1, \ 298 *oq1 = vbsl##r##u8(flat, tq1, *oq1); \ 315 uint8x8_t *op0, uint8x8_t *oq0, uint8x8_t *oq1, uint8x8_t *oq2, 337 *oq1 = apply_15_tap_filter_8_kernel(flat2, p6, q0, q1, q7, *oq1, &sum) 867 op2, op1, op0, oq0, oq1, oq2, mask, flat, hev; local 886 op2, op1, op0, oq0, oq1, oq2, mask, flat, hev; local 902 op2, op1, op0, oq0, oq1, oq2, mask, flat, hev; local 922 op2, op1, op0, oq0, oq1, oq2, mask, flat, hev; local 981 op5, op4, op3, op2, op1, op0, oq0, oq1, oq2, oq3, oq4, oq5, oq6; local 998 op6, op5, op4, op3, op2, op1, op0, oq0, oq1, oq2, oq3, oq4, oq5, oq6; local 1021 op5, op4, op3, op2, op1, op0, oq0, oq1, oq2, oq3, oq4, oq5, oq6; local 1053 op6, op5, op4, op3, op2, op1, op0, oq0, oq1, oq2, oq3, oq4, oq5, oq6; local [all...] |
/external/libvpx/libvpx/vpx_dsp/x86/ |
loopfilter_sse2.c | 30 /* const uint8_t hev = hev_mask(thresh, *op1, *op0, *oq0, *oq1); */ \ 138 _mm_storeh_pi((__m64 *)(s + 1 * p), _mm_castsi128_ps(qs1qs0)); // *oq1 608 __m128i op2, op1, op0, oq0, oq1, oq2; local 695 oq1 = _mm_xor_si128(q1, t80); 699 filt = _mm_and_si128(_mm_subs_epi8(op1, oq1), hev); [all...] |
/external/webp/src/dsp/ |
dec_neon.c | 716 uint8x16_t* const oq0, uint8x16_t* const oq1) { 727 *oq1 = FlipSignBack_NEON(vqsubq_s8(q1, a3)); // clip(q1 - a3) 845 uint8x16_t op2, op1, op0, oq0, oq1, oq2; local 862 uint8x16_t op2, op1, op0, oq0, oq1, oq2; local 927 uint8x16_t op2, op1, op0, oq0, oq1, oq2; local 945 uint8x16_t op1, op0, oq0, oq1; local 960 uint8x16_t op2, op1, op0, oq0, oq1, oq2; local 977 uint8x16_t op1, op0, oq0, oq1; local [all...] |